pumpkin seeds health benefits | Pumpkin seeds or pumpkin seeds are full of nutrients, as eating just a small amount can provide you with a large amount of healthy fats, magnesium and zinc.
For this reason, pumpkin seeds have been associated with many health benefits; these benefits include improved heart health, prostate health, and protection against some types of cancer.
pumpkin seeds health benefits:
High nutritional value:
An ounce of pumpkin seeds contains:
- Approximately 151 calories from fat and protein.
- Fiber: 1.7 grams
- Carbs: 5 grams
- Protein: 7 grams
- Fat: 13 grams (6 of which are omega-6s).
- Vitamin K: 18% of a person’s need per day.
- Phosphorous: 33% of a person’s need per day.
- Manganese: 42% of the human need per day.
- Magnesium: 37% of a person’s need, per day.
- Iron: 23% of a person’s need, per day.
- Zinc: 14% of a person’s need, per day.
- Copper: 19% of a person’s need per day.
- It also contains a lot of antioxidants.
- Amount of polyunsaturated fatty acid, potassium, vitamin B2 (riboflavin) and folate.

High in antioxidants:
- Pumpkin seeds contain antioxidants such as carotenoids and vitamins , especially vitamin E.
- Antioxidants can reduce inflammation and protect your cells from harmful free radicals.
- This is why eating foods rich in antioxidants can help protect against many diseases.
- The high levels of antioxidants in pumpkin seeds are believed to be partly responsible for their positive effects on health.

Improve prostate and bladder health:
- Pumpkin seeds may help relieve symptoms of benign prostatic hyperplasia (BPH), a condition in which the prostate gland enlarges, causing problems with urination.
- Taking pumpkin seeds or pumpkin products as a supplement can help treat symptoms of an overactive bladder.
High levels of magnesium:
Magnesium is needed for more than 600 chemical reactions in your body. Pumpkin seeds are one of the best natural sources of magnesium, adequate levels of magnesium are important for:
- Control of blood pressure.
- Reducing the risk of heart disease.
- Shaping and forming healthy bones.
- Regulating blood sugar levels.
Improves heart health:
- Pumpkin seeds are a good source of antioxidants, magnesium, zinc, and fatty acids, all of which help keep your heart healthy.
- Pumpkin seed oil may reduce high blood pressure and high cholesterol levels, which are two important risk factors for heart disease
- Lower diastolic blood pressure and increase good cholesterol levels in postmenopausal women.
- Pumpkin’s ability to increase nitric oxide generation in your body may be responsible for its positive effects on heart health.
- Nitric oxide helps widen blood vessels, improves blood flow and reduces the risk of plaque growth in the arteries.
Useful for diabetics:
- Pumpkin, pumpkin seeds, pumpkin seed powder and pumpkin juice can reduce blood sugar.
- Control blood sugar levels.
- Supplementing with pumpkin juice or seed powder reduces blood sugar levels in patients with type 2 diabetes.
- The high magnesium content in pumpkin seeds is responsible for its positive effect on diabetes.
- Diets rich in magnesium have been linked to a reduced risk of type 2 diabetes.

pumpkin seeds health benefits in the treatment of insomnia:
- Helps improve sleep If you are having trouble falling asleep, you may need to eat some pumpkin seeds before bed.
- They are a natural source of tryptophan, which is an amino acid that can help promote sleep.
- The zinc in these seeds also helps convert Tryptophan into serotonin, which is then converted into melatonin, the hormone that regulates your sleep cycle.
- Pumpkin seeds are an excellent source of magnesium. Adequate magnesium levels have also been linked to better sleep.
- Taking magnesium supplements improved sleep quality and overall sleep time in people with low magnesium levels.
